The Citroën CX, produced from 1974 to 1991, is a groundbreaking mid-size luxury car that left an indelible mark on the automotive world. Known for its aerodynamic design, innovative technology, and distinctive driving experience, the CX represented a departure from the traditional automotive norms of its time. The CX's sleek, streamlined bodywork, penned by renowned designer Robert Opron, boasted a drag coefficient of just 0.36, making it one of the most aerodynamic cars of its era. This aerodynamic efficiency translated into exceptional fuel economy and a quiet, comfortable ride. Underneath its stylish exterior, the CX featured a range of technological advancements, including a self-leveling hydropneumatic suspension system that ensured a smooth and controlled ride even on uneven roads. The suspension also allowed for variable ride height, offering both comfort and off-road capability.

The CX's interior was equally impressive, characterized by its spacious cabin and high-quality materials. The expansive dashboard featured an array of sophisticated controls and gauges, highlighting the car's advanced technology. From its initial introduction in 1974, the CX underwent several revisions and updates throughout its production run. These changes included engine improvements, new trim levels, and the addition of more powerful and fuel-efficient powertrains. The CX's range spanned a diverse selection of engine options, ranging from economical four-cylinder units to powerful six-cylinder engines. The CX was not only a technological marvel but also a testament to Citroën's commitment to innovation and design. Its influence can be seen in subsequent Citroën models and even other cars of its era. The CX remains a coveted classic, cherished by enthusiasts for its unique blend of style, comfort, and performance.
